What’s a Registered Agent

A registered agent is an person or a legal entity chosen to get legal documents and critical notices on for a business.  registered agent ratings  ensures that the firm stays compliant with local regulations and maintains good standing. The registered agent acts as a liaison between the firm and the government, receiving documents like lawsuits, tax information, and formal correspondence.

The qualifications for a registered agent vary by region, but generally, the registered agent must have a real address within the area of registration and be reachable during typical working hours. This can be an owner, like a entrepreneur, or a dedicated agent service that is dedicated in managing these responsibilities. Many businesses opt to hire a registered agent provider to streamline their compliance and concentrate on their core operations.

Having a reliable registered agent is essential for upholding the legal and operational validity of a company. If a company neglects to have a designated agent or if that agent is unavailable, it may face severe penalties, including sanctions or even forfeiting its ability to operate in the state. Therefore, comprehending the responsibilities and obligations of a registered agent is fundamental for all business owner.

Pricing Analysis of Registered Representative Services

In the process of evaluating a designated agent solution, cost is an important consideration to assess. The costs of registered agents can vary significantly based on the provider, the type of service provided, and whether the service operates on a national scale or is more localized. It's common to find services ranging from a budget-friendly option to higher premium packages that offer additional benefits such as regulatory notifications and document management. Grasping the pricing can help businesses identify the most suitable registered agent service that fits their financial plan and requirements.

Many registered agent services require an annual cost, which can typically range from as low as $50 to exceeding $300 per year. The cheapest registered agent solutions might provide fundamental compliance without the frills, while professional registered agents may justify a increased fee with enhanced features aimed at ensuring adherence to legal standards. Companies should thoroughly assess what is covered in the cost before reaching a choice, taking into account if the cost aligns with the expected standard of service and assistance.

Compliance Needs and Compliance

Every business entity, whether an Limited Liability Company or a corporation, is mandated to have a designated agent as part of its formation and operation. The statutory registered agent acts as the designated point of contact for judicial papers, including tax documents and lawsuit papers. This requirement is dictated by state regulations, which require that the registered agent must have a physical address in the state of incorporation and be available during regular business hours. Failure to maintain a registered agent can result in serious repercussions, including fines, sanctions, and even the loss of compliance status for your business.

Adherence with registered agent legal requirements is crucial to ensure that your business remains in compliance with the state. This includes quickly updating any changes to the registered agent appointment, such as a change of address or agent. Businesses must also be aware of the distinct responsibilities that a registered agent holds, which encompass receiving and sending legal documents correctly. Ignoring these compliance responsibilities can result in overlooked deadlines or legal notices, which could threaten a business’s capacity to respond to lawsuits or other court proceedings.
